Как добавить ярлыки в меню питания Windows (WinX) с помощью hashlnk

Меню питания (Power Menu или WinX) — это контекстное меню, которое открывается сочетанием клавиш Win+X. Оно даёт быстрый доступ к системным инструментам. Но по умолчанию туда не всегда попадают нужные вам приложения. Утилита hashlnk создаёт специальный тип ярлыка, который отображается в этом меню.
Кому это полезно
- Обычным пользователям, которые хотят ускорить доступ к часто используемым инструментам.
- Системным администраторам, которым нужно стандартизировать набор пунктов в меню на рабочих станциях.
- Техникам и энтузиастам, желающим кастомизировать интерфейс Windows.
Что требуется
- Компьютер с Windows 10 или Windows 11.
- Доступ к учётной записи с правами пользователя (администратор не обязателен для базовой операции, но может потребоваться в окружениях с политиками).
- Немного внимания при выполнении команд в командной строке.
Как скачать hashlnk
- Откройте страницу загрузки hashlnk на GitHub и нажмите “Download”.
- Скачивается ZIP-файл. Чтобы распаковать, щёлкните по нему правой кнопкой и выберите «Извлечь всё». Затем нажмите «Извлечь», чтобы распаковать содержимое в ту же папку, где хранится ZIP.
- Откройте распакованную папку — там должен быть один файл: hashlnk.exe.
Не закрывайте это окно — оно ещё понадобится дальше.
Как добавить ярлык в меню питания с помощью hashlnk
Ниже пошаговая инструкция. Язык интерфейса Windows не влияет на выполнение команд.
1) Создайте обычный ярлык приложения
- Нажмите Win + S и введите имя приложения или системной функции (в примере — «Панель управления»).
- В результатах поиска щёлкните правой кнопкой по элементу и выберите «Открыть расположение файла».
- Появится папка с ярлыком. Оставьте это окно открытым.
2) Откройте папку WinX
- Нажмите Win + R, чтобы открыть диалог Выполнить.
- Вставьте и выполните:
%LocalAppdata%\Microsoft\Windows\WinX- Откроется папка WinX с тремя подпапками: Group1, Group2 и Group3. Эти группы соответствуют расположению пунктов в меню: Group1 — нижняя группа, Group2 — средняя, Group3 — верхняя.
3) Скопируйте обычный ярлык в нужную группу
Скопируйте созданный ранее ярлык и вставьте его в одну из подпапок Group1/Group2/Group3. В примере ярлык Панели управления был вставлен в Group2.
Важно: после вставки обычный ярлык не появится в меню — требуется преобразование в специальный тип ярлыка.
4) Запустите командную строку и выполните hashlnk
- Откройте Выполнить (Win + R), введите cmd и нажмите Enter, чтобы открыть командную строку.
- Получите путь к hashlnk.exe: вернитесь к папке, где вы распаковали hashlnk, щёлкните по hashlnk.exe правой кнопкой и выберите «Копировать как путь».
(На Windows 10: в проводнике выберите hashlnk.exe, а затем на вкладке Home нажмите «Copy path» в секции Clipboard.)
- Вставьте скопированный путь в окно CMD (щёлкните правой кнопкой мыши в окне cmd).
- Затем вставьте через пробел полный путь к обычному ярлыку, который вы поместили в одну из папок WinX. Итоговая команда должна содержать два пути: путь к hashlnk.exe и путь к ярлыку в GroupX.
Пример (пути у вас будут другими):
- Нажмите Enter, чтобы выполнить команду.
5) Перезагрузите компьютер
После перезагрузки откройте меню Win+X — там появится новый пункт. Чтобы удалить его, просто удалите оригинальный ярлык из той Group-папки, в которую вы его поместили.
Совет по выбору группы
- Group3 — пункты, которые вы хотите видеть в верхней части меню (например, Диспетчер задач).
- Group2 — средние, логичные системные инструменты.
- Group1 — нижняя часть, редко используемые или вспомогательные элементы.
Выберите группу, исходя из частоты использования и логики расположения.
Альтернативы и когда hashlnk не подходит
- Если вы предпочитаете графический интерфейс — используйте WinX Menu Editor. Он даёт визуальное управление группами и пунктами.
- В корпоративной среде с управлением через групповые политики добавление ярлыков вручную может конфликтовать с политиками безопасности — согласуйте изменения с IT.
- Если приложение установлено как универсальная платформа (UWP) и у него нет классического ярлыка, может потребоваться создать специальный лейаут или использовать PowerShell-скрипты.
Критерии приёмки
- После перезагрузки в меню Win+X появился ожидаемый ярлык.
- Ярлык корректно запускает целевое приложение или системную функцию.
- При удалении ярлыка из папки WinX пункт исчезает из меню после следующей перезагрузки.
Быстрые проверки и отладка
- Если новый пункт не появляется — проверьте, что вы выполнили команду hashlnk из той же учётной записи, где находятся папки WinX.
- Убедитесь, что вы вставили путь к ярлыку именно из папки Group1/2/3, а не из оригинального расположения.
- Попробуйте запустить командную строку от имени администратора, если окружение ограничено политиками.
Безопасность и конфиденциальность
- hashlnk — локальная утилита. Она не должна отправлять данные в сеть. Тем не менее скачивайте её только с официальной страницы проекта на GitHub.
- В корпоративной среде проверяйте репутацию и подпись исполняемого файла перед развёртыванием.
Шаблон действий для администратора (чеклист)
- Скачал и проверил hashlnk на тестовой машине.
- Создал список требуемых ярлыков и назначил группы (Group1/2/3).
- Распаковал hashlnk и разместил ярлыки в папках WinX на тестовой машине.
- Выполнил команды hashlnk в CMD и перезагрузил тестовую машину.
- Подтвердил работоспособность и отсутствие конфликтов с политиками.
- Автоматизировал процесс скриптом или распределил инструкцию пользователям.
Короткое руководство по откату
- Удалите добавленный ярлык из соответствующей папки Group1/2/3.
- Перезагрузите компьютер. Пункт исчезнет из меню.
Частые ошибки и решения
- Ошибка: “Файл не найден” — проверьте, что путь к ярлыку и к hashlnk указаны верно и в кавычках, если есть пробелы.
- Ошибка: пункт не отображается после перезагрузки — попробуйте очистить кэш оболочки или перезагрузиться ещё раз; проверьте права доступа к папке WinX.
1‑строчный глоссарий
- WinX: меню питания Windows, открывается через Win+X.
- hashlnk: утилита для создания особых ярлыков, отображаемых в WinX.
- Group1/2/3: подпапки в %LocalAppdata%\Microsoft\Windows\WinX, определяющие расположение элементов.
Краткое резюме
Добавление ярлыков в меню питания Windows через hashlnk — это простой способ кастомизировать Win+X. Процесс включает скачивание утилиты, копирование обычного ярлыка в нужную папку WinX, выполнение hashlnk из командной строки и перезагрузку. Для пользователей, предпочитающих GUI, подходит WinX Menu Editor.
Важное: скачивайте утилиты только из официальных источников и учитывайте корпоративные политики безопасности.
Похожие материалы
Как искать комментарии в посте Reddit
Как пожаловаться на пользователя в Reddit
4 бесплатные AI‑игры от Google Arts & Culture
Красивая страница обслуживания для WordPress
Состояния питания Windows 11: S0–G3 объяснено